Fault code C (Flashing) appears across 1 boiler brand and 3 models. The exact meaning varies by manufacturer — pick your boiler brand below to see the model-specific fix.

Most common meaning Your boiler has been manually or accidentally switched into a service testing mode, meaning it is running at a restricted low power level rather than responding to your heating demands. (As reported on Halstead Ace HE)
